A drug dealer has been jailed for more than three years.
Tajamul Hussain was sentenced to three years and nine months for supplying heroin, supplying cocaine and possessing heroin.
The case against him began on May 20 last year when police stopped a car in Handel Street, Allenton. Hussain, who was driving at the time, was searched and was found to be carrying wraps of drugs.
The 33-year-old, of Portland Street, Derby, admitted the charges and was sentenced at Derby Crown Court.
